IT Manager

 

JOB DESCRIPTION
Job TitleIT ManagerDate IssuedOctober 2019
LocationToronto
Reporting ToCOO
 

Job Summary:

 

The IT Manager is responsible for the execution of the overall technology strategy while directing IT operations and governance through value-driven solutions for both Toronto and Montreal offices  . This individual will be “hands on” and plan, coordinate, direct, and design IT-related activities of the organization, as well as provide administrative direction and support for daily operational activities of the IT department. The IT Manager will work closely with decision makers in other departments to identify, recommend, develop, implement, and support cost-effective technology solutions for all aspects of the organization. This person will also define and implement IT policies, procedures, and best practices.

 

 

Key Accountabilities:

  • Manage external vendors and internal teams including monitoring budgetary performance, reviewing and recommending all capital expenditures, while creating effective partnerships and negotiating advantageous agreements with external service providers and software vendors
  • Improves business processes and reduces costs within IT function and elsewhere in the organization.
  • Day-to-day management and planning of desktop support team comprised of 1-2 employees.. Lead by example through appropriate hands-on participation and oversight of all IT activities
  • Proven background experience in IT infrastructure, software development, and IT management
  • Provide expert counsel and guidance to senior management on information technology and its impact across the full range of business strategy, programs, products and services, and operational issues.
  • Work with senior leadership team to identify and manage risks to operational activities, planned and unplanned changes that may impact service levels

 

 

Skills and Behaviour:

 

  • Strong problem-solving skills and experience interacting with business units and discussing business strategies, planning and processes
  • Proven track record in leading a team of IT professionals and delivering customer service to a dynamic business organization
  • Detailed knowledge of IT Operations procedures and processes
  • Ability to work effectively and set pri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ong communication and presentation skills.
  • Solid business sense with a strong customer focus.
  • Industry recognized certification is an asset
 

Education and Experience:

 

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, Information Management Systems, or equivalent professional degree with 5-7 years of relevant technical and 2-3 years of managerial experience
  • At least 5 years of experience leading a diverse network consisting of multiple offices and external networks
  • A broad knowledge of IT and business processes required to support enterprise voice and data network environments, experience with next generation networking platforms, specifically WAN (WAN), and cloud connect protocols.
